Abstract

Irradiation of dissociating cyclopentadienone-dimers (2 b, c, e) results in formation of two types of cage-products (5 and 8) in very low quantum yields and good, but wavelength and phase dependent chemical yields. Both processes are intramolecular, for 2b this was shown using isotopic labeling and massspectrometric techniques. Sensitization and quenching experiments indicate that triplet states are involved The mechanistic pathways are discussed. The cyclopentadienones(1 b,c,e) were isolated for the first time and irradiation of 1b in the solid gave exclusively the symmetric cage (8b).
